<TD ALIGN="left" VALIGN="top"><B>Other Events </B></TD></TR></TABLE> <P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">On November&nbsp;8, 2017, MEI Pharma, Inc. (the &#147;<U>Company</U>&#148;), entered into
an At-The-Market Equity Offering Sales Agreement (the &#147;<U>Sales Agreement</U>&#148;) with Stifel, Nicolaus&nbsp;&amp; Company, Incorporated, as sales agent, pursuant to which the Company may sell, from time to time, an aggregate of up to
$30,000,000 of its common stock, par value $0.00000002 per share (the &#147;<U>Shares</U>&#148;). </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">The Shares may be issued and sold from time to time
through the sales agent pursuant to the Company&#146;s shelf Registration Statement on Form S-3 (Reg. No.&nbsp;333-217645). The Company has filed a prospectus supplement, dated November&nbsp;8, 2017, pursuant to Rule&nbsp;424(b) under the Securities
Act of 1933, as amended, with respect to the Shares. Sales of the Shares, if any, under this prospectus supplement may be made in transactions that are deemed to be &#147;at the market offerings&#148; pursuant to Rule 415 under the Securities Act of
1933, as amended, including by means of ordinary brokers&#146; transactions on the Nasdaq Capital Market at market prices, in block transactions, or as otherwise agreed upon by the sales agent and us.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">The Company will pay the sales agent a commission of up to 3% of the gross sales price per share for any Shares sold through the sales agent under the Sales
Agreement. We have provided the sales agent with customary indemnification and contribution rights.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">The foregoing description is qualified in its
entirety by reference to the Sales Agreement, a copy of which is included as Exhibit 1.1 hereto and is incorporated by reference herein. </P> <P STYLE="font-size:18pt;margin-top:0pt;margin-bottom:0pt">&nbsp;</P>

date or dates indicated in such certificate.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:4%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Section&nbsp;2. <U>Sale and Delivery of Shares</U>.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:8%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">(a) Subject to the terms and conditions set forth herein, the Company agrees to issue and sell exclusively through the Agent acting as sales
agent or directly to the Agent acting as principal from time to time, and the Agent agrees to use its commercially reasonable efforts to sell as sales agent for the Company, the Shares. Sales of the Shares, if any, through the Agent acting as sales
agent or directly to the Agent acting as principal may be made in negotiated transactions or transactions that are deemed to be <FONT STYLE="white-space:nowrap"><FONT STYLE="white-space:nowrap">&#147;at-the-market</FONT></FONT> offerings&#148; as
defined in Rule 415 under the 1933 Act, including sales made directly on the NASDAQ Capital Market, or sales made to or through a market maker other than on an exchange or through an electronic communications network.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:8%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">(b) The Shares are to be sold on a daily basis or otherwise as shall be agreed to by the Company and the Agent on that trading day (other than
a day on which the NASDAQ Capital Market is scheduled to close prior to its regular weekday closing time, each, a &#147;<U>Trading Day</U>&#148;) that the Company has satisfied its obligations under Section&nbsp;6 of this Agreement and that the
Company has instructed the Agent to make such sales. </P>

 <P STYLE="margin-top:0p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">
For the avoidance of doubt, the foregoing limitation shall not apply to sales solely to employees or security holders of the Company or its subsidiaries, or to a trustee or other person acquiring
such securities for the accounts of such persons in which Stifel Nicolaus is acting for the Company in a capacity other than as Agent under this Agreement. On any Trading Day, the Company may instruct the Agent by telephone (confirmed promptly by
telecopy or email, which confirmation will be promptly acknowledged by the Agent) as to the maximum number of Shares to be sold by the Agent on such day (in any event not in excess of the number available for issuance under the Prospectus and the
currently effective Registration Statement) and the minimum price per Share at which such Shares may be sold. Subject to the terms and conditions hereof, the Agent shall use its commercially reasonable efforts to sell as sales agent all of the
Shares so designated by the Company. The Company and the Agent each acknowledge and agree that (A)&nbsp;there can be no assurance that the Agent will be successful in selling the Shares, (B)&nbsp;the Agent will incur no liability or obligation to
the Company or any other person or entity if they do not sell Shares for any reason other than a failure by the Agent to use its commercially reasonable efforts consistent with its normal trading and sales practices and applicable law and
regulations to sell such Shares as required by this Agreement, and (C)&nbsp;the Agent shall be under no obligation to purchase Shares on a principal basis except as otherwise specifically agreed by each of the Agent and the Company pursuant to a
Terms Agreement. In the event of a conflict between the terms of this Agreement and the terms of a Terms Agreement, the terms of such Terms Agreement will control.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:8%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">(c) Notwithstanding the foregoing, the Company shall not authorize the issuance and sale of, and the Agent as sales agent shall not be
obligated to use its commercially reasonable efforts to sell, any Shares (i)&nbsp;at a price lower than the minimum price therefor authorized from time to time, or (ii)&nbsp;in a number in excess of the number of Shares authorized from time to time
to be issued and sold under this Agreement, in each case, by the Company&#146;s board of directors, or a duly authorized committee thereof, and notified to the Agent in writing. In addition, the Company may, upon notice to the Agent, suspend the
offering of the Shares or the Agent may, upon notice to the Company, suspend the offering of the Shares with respect to which the Agent is acting as sales agent for any reason and at any time; <U>provided</U>, <U>however</U>, that such suspension or
termination shall not affect or impair the parties&#146; respective obligations with respect to the Shares sold hereunder prior to the giving of such notice. Any notice given pursuant to the preceding sentence may be given by telephone (confirmed
promptly by telecopy or email, which confirmation will be promptly acknowledged). </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:8%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">(d) The gross sales price of any Shares sold pursuant to
this Agreement by the Agent acting as sales agent of the Company shall be the market price prevailing at the time of sale for shares of the Company&#146;s Common Stock sold by the Agent on the NASDAQ Capital Market or otherwise, at prices relating
to prevailing market prices or at negotiated prices. The compensation payable to the Agent for sales of Shares with respect to which the Agent acts as sales agent shall be up to 3.0% of the gross sales price of the Shares sold pursuant to this
Agreement. The Company may sell Shares to the Agent, acting as principal, at a price agreed upon with the Agent at the relevant Applicable Time and pursuant to a separate Terms Agreement. The remaining proceeds, after further deduction for any
transaction fees imposed by any governmental, regulatory or self-regulatory organization in respect of such sales, shall constitute the net proceeds to the Company for such Shares (the &#147;<U>Net Proceeds</U>&#148;). The Agent shall notify the
Company as promptly as practicable if any deduction referenced in the preceding sentence will be required.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:8%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">(e) If acting as a sales agent
hereunder, the Agent shall provide written confirmation to the Company following the close of trading on the NASDAQ Capital Market, each day in which Shares are sold under this Agreement setting forth the number of Shares sold on such day, the
aggregate gross sales proceeds of the Shares, the Net Proceeds to the Company and the compensation payable by the Company to such Agent with respect to such sales.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; text-indent:8%;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">(f) Under no circumstances shall the aggregate offering price or number, as the case may be, of Shares sold pursuant to this Agreement and any
Terms Agreement exceed the aggregate offering price or number, as the case may be, of Shares of Common Stock (i)&nbsp;set forth in the preamble paragraph of this Agreement, (ii)&nbsp;available for issuance under the Prospectus and the then currently
effective Registration Statement or (iii)&nbsp;authorized from time to time to be issued and sold under this Agreement or any Terms Agreement by the Company&#146;s board of directors, or a duly authorized committee thereof, and notified to the Agent
in writing. In addition, under no circumstances shall any Shares with respect to which the Agent acts as sales agent be sold at a price lower than the minimum price therefor authorized from time to time by the Company&#146;s board of directors, or a
duly authorized committee thereof, and notified to the Agent in writing. </P>
